Kamungeremu retains ZNCC presidency | Business Times

PHILLIMON MHLANGA IN VICTORIA FALLS

 

Tendo Electronics managing director, Mike Kamungeremu, has been re-elected to serve a second term as the Zimbabwe National Chamber of Commerce (ZNCC) president, Business Times can report.

Kamungeremu, who was re-elected at the industrial body’s annual general meeting,  was confirmed at the Presidential dinner held Thursday night.

Chalton Chambira, the general manager of Holiday Inn Bulawayo, was also re-elected as ZNCC deputy president.

Kamungeremu was first elected ZNCC president in July 2022 following the end of Tinashe Manzungu’s tenure.

In his acceptance speech, Kamungeremu, who holds a Bachelor of Accountancy (Honours) Degree and a Master of Business Administration from the University of Zimbabwe expressed gratitude  to ZNCC executive committee for their trust in re-electing him .

“I am humbled to be re-elected president of the ZNCC for a second term. It’s a show of confidence. What I promise is the same energy, same determination. I promise  that for the next year, I will put my all into this,” Kamungeremu said.
